## Runbook: TideGlass Widget — Restart Procedure

Before restarting the TideGlass tide-table widget on the Harborline cluster, verify that the prediction cache has flushed cleanly; a partial flush will serve stale high-water times to downstream pages. Confirm the scheduler lock in the Moonpool coordinator is released, then stop the renderer, wait thirty seconds, and start it again. For audit purposes, record the restart in the Harborline change log. The service reads the following configuration values at startup.

config for kajef-hahof:
[ulamir]
port = 5672
region = central-1
host = ulamir.lumicsys.corp
timeout_ms = 2000
retries = 3

Plugin authors: don't implement your own retry loop for failed exports. The Fernwick export host already retries with jittered backoff, and stacking your retries on top of ours causes duplicate bundles downstream in Cartonware. If an export fails, return the error and let the host reschedule. Override behavior only via the documented constants, not by wrapping calls. Anything beyond three host-level attempts needs sign-off from the platform team. The defaults we ship are below.

constants for fajop-tahaf:
RATE_LIMITS = {
    "holael": 2,
    "oliael": 10,
    "druael": 10,
    "wenwyn": 10,
}

Subject: Inventory Write-Down — Brindel Components

All,

We are writing down obsolete Brindel connector stock this quarter. Impact is contained; margins on current lines are unaffected. Do not discount remaining units without approval from Tomas Greaves. Clearance channels are being arranged centrally. Full numbers at Thursday's call. Background on where this fits is below.

confidential, kagup-bafog: Fraaxax Group is in early talks to buy Soroxox Group for about $343.8 million. The Olidor launch date is June 14, and nothing goes to the press before then. Legal wants the Aldmirek Logistics term sheet signed before July 23.

Provenance — vendored fonts at Brambletype. We vendor third-party typefaces into the repo rather than fetching at build time, so releases are reproducible offline. Each font drop is reviewed for license terms and checked in with its upstream version noted. The packaging job stamps every bundle; verify a release's font set against the token recorded below.

build token for kagaf-hahof: htk14_9d3d4d26d7d8de